Abstract
In [Z.Wei, S. Yao, L. Liu, The convergence properties of some new conjugate gradient methods, Applied Mathematics and Computation 183 (2006) 1341–1350], Wei et al. proposed a new conjugate gradient method called WYL method which has good numerical experiments and some excellent properties such as βkWYL⩾0. In this paper, we prove that while tk⩽1-c2L‖gk‖2‖dk‖2, the sufficient descent condition can be satisfied at each iteration of the WYL method. Based on this, the global convergence of the WYL method with the standard Armijo line search and the generalized Wolfe–Powell line search is established.
